The Pokémon franchise has maintained a passionate global following since its creation by Game Freak and The Pokémon Company, powering blockbuster game releases for Nintendo platforms such as the Nintendo Switch and generating a vibrant online community.
However, with such immense popularity comes heated debate and, at times, negativity across social spaces.
Recognizing the desire for a more positive outlet within the Pokémon community, former Nintendo Life journalist Ryan Craddock has introduced a new YouTube initiative called 'Amphie.'
Ryan Craddock, well-known for his contributions to Nintendo-focused coverage and previously recognized as a staff writer for Nintendo Life, aims to offer Pokémon fans a welcoming, chill corner of the internet.
Describing Amphie as "a chill, calming place to discuss all things Pokémon," Craddock envisions the channel as a safe haven from the drama that often surfaces around the Pokémon franchise—particularly on social media and fan forums.
The project promises to emphasize the fun, nostalgic, and uplifting aspects that have sustained Pokémon’s immense popularity for more than two decades.
In his introductory video, Craddock invites fans, both new and veteran, to join a space focused on positivity, constructive conversation, and community engagement.
"There’s plenty of noise out there, but Amphie will be about celebrating Pokémon and keeping things upbeat," says Craddock in his announcement.
The channel launch is well-timed; with the Pokémon franchise maintaining strong momentum through regular mainline game releases and updates—such as expansions for Pokémon Scarlet and Violet on the Nintendo Switch—enthusiasts are constantly seeking fresh, enjoyable content.
Craddock's past experience, which famously includes playing guitar alongside Shigeru Miyamoto, adds a unique credibility and charm to his new hosting role.
Amphie's first official video is scheduled for release next week, with future content set to include discussions, retrospectives, and interactive features for viewers.
In addition to Amphie, Craddock is developing a new musical project unrelated to Pokémon, anticipated for later this year.
